2015-S8148 (ACTIVE) - Summary

Establishes the "New York's Own combat veterans healthcare choice program act" to establish tax free savings accounts to pay the healthcare costs of combat veterans on active duty during Operation Enduring Freedom or Operation Iraqi Freedom, until covered by the federal government.

                    S T A T E   O F   N E W   Y O R K
________________________________________________________________________

                                  8148

                            I N  S E N A T E

                              June 14, 2016
                               ___________

Introduced  by  Sens.  MURPHY,  CROCI,  LARKIN -- read twice and ordered
  printed, and when printed to be committed to the Committee on Rules

AN ACT to amend the military law, the state finance law, the civil prac-
  tice law and rules and the tax law, in relation to  establishing  "New
  York's Own combat veterans healthcare choice program act"

  THE  P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, REPRESENTED IN SENATE AND ASSEM-
BLY, DO ENACT AS FOLLOWS:

  Section 1. Short title. This act shall be known and may  be  cited  as
the "New York's Own combat veterans healthcare choice program act".
  S 2. The military law is amended by adding a new section 216-a to read
as follows:
  S 216-A. MEDICAL CARE WHEN INJURED OR DISABLED IN COMBAT ZONE.  1. ANY
NEW  YORK  RESIDENT  MEMBER  OF THE ORGANIZED MILITIA WHO SHALL, WHEN ON
ACTIVE DUTY IN A COMBAT ZONE, DESIGNATED BY THE PRESIDENT OF THE  UNITED
STATES DURING OPERATION ENDURING FREEDOM OR OPERATION IRAQI FREEDOM, FOR
THREE  HUNDRED  SIXTY DAYS OR MORE ON ORDERS ISSUED BY THE GOVERNOR, THE
COMMANDING GENERAL OF THE NEW YORK ARMY NATIONAL GUARD,  THE  COMMANDING
OFFICER  OF THE NEW YORK AIR NATIONAL GUARD OR THE COMMANDING OFFICER OF
THE NAVAL MILITIA, RECEIVE ANY WOUND OR INJURY, OR INCUR OR CONTRACT ANY
DISABILITY OR DISEASE, BY REASON OF SUCH  DUTY,  OR  WHO  SHALL  WITHOUT
FAULT  OR  NEGLECT  ON  HIS  OR  HER  PART  BE WOUNDED OR DISABLED WHILE
PERFORMING ANY LAWFULLY ORDERED DUTY WHILE IN SUCH A COMBAT ZONE,  WHICH
SHALL  INCAPACITATE  HIM  OR HER, AND WHO IS UNABLE TO RECEIVE TIMELY OR
ADEQUATE HEALTHCARE SERVICES FROM THE  FEDERAL  DEPARTMENT  OF  VETERANS
AFFAIRS WITHIN NINETY DAYS OF MAKING APPLICATION FOR SUCH SERVICES SHALL
RECEIVE  THE PAYMENT INTO SUCH SERVICE MEMBER'S NEW YORK COMBAT VETERANS
HEALTHCARE CHOICE ACCOUNT ESTABLISHED PURSUANT TO  ARTICLE  FOURTEEN  OF
THIS  CHAPTER  FOR  CARE  AND MEDICAL TREATMENT IF AUTHORITY THEREFOR IS
GRANTED BY THE ADJUTANT GENERAL, EXPENSES FOR SUCH    CARE  AND  MEDICAL
ATTENDANCE  AS ARE NECESSARY FOR THE APPROPRIATE TREATMENT OF THE WOUND,
INJURY, DISEASE OR DISABILITY MAY BE  PAID  FROM  THE  NEW  YORK  COMBAT
VETERANS  HEALTHCARE  CHOICE  ACCOUNT AS PROVIDED IN ARTICLE FOURTEEN OF
THIS CHAPTER UNTIL TREATMENT IS PROVIDED BY THE FEDERAL VETERANS  ADMIN-
ISTRATION,  OR THE INCAPACITY RESULTING FROM SUCH WOUND, INJURY, DISEASE
